After putting in an offer on the Montgomery Dr house, we were countered…and we accepted their counter. Once this was on paper and we signed our lives away, we needed to set up the home inspection. We hired Eagle Inspections to come out on Saturday 10/14/2023. The house is empty so it was easier to move around and check things and take measurements. (now we need to figure out what’s going where).

The biggest concern in the home inspection was “the roof”…this will be the first project and I am sure will get a few posts.

The background is, the owners knew that a new roof was needed, but it was ONLY near-end-of-life, so we were thinking that we had a couple years to deal with it. Well, we found out that the roof was END of life, there are leaks, some damage from what may have been a felled tree and the attic fan no longer works so there is some moisture in the attic crawl space.

This was something that may have changed the whole deal…we were told by the inspector that we were looking at $25k (minimum)…this wasn’t something that I wanted to put up first thing…there are too many other smaller projects that would be put off too long!!

They got an estimate and allowed us to get an estimate…the real numbers were a lot less scary. They came back with an estimate from an Amish Roofing company and Rich McHugh came back with a number that was in the same range.

We OFFICIALLY bought a house on 10/24/2023 – Settlement is on 12/4/2023!!
